Задача к ЕГЭ по информатике на тему «Задачи с дополнительными условиями» №7

В компьютерной системе необходимо выполнить некоторое количество вычислительных процессов, которые могут выполняться параллельно или последовательно. Для запуска некоторых процессов необходимы данные, которые получаются как результаты выполнения одного или двух других процессов – поставщиков данных. Независимые процессы (не имеющие поставщиков данных) можно запускать в любой момент времени. Если процесс B (зависимый процесс) получает данные от процесса A (поставщика данных), то процесс B может начать выполнение сразу же после завершения процесса A. Любые процессы, готовые к выполнению, можно запускать параллельно, при этом количество одновременно выполняемых процессов может быть любым, длительность процесса не зависит от других параллельно выполняемых процессов.

В таблице представлены идентификатор (ID) каждого процесса, его длительность и ID поставщиков данных для зависимых процессов.

Определите разность времени выполнения самого быстрого и самого долгого процессов.

Для начала распределим значения из столбца C. Для этого выделим данные в этом столбце и с помощью кнопок «Данные»->«Текст по столбцам» расформируем их на разные столбцы.

В ячейку G2 поместим формулу МАКС(E2 : F 2) + B2  и растянем её вниз. В ячейку E2 поместим формулу =ВПР(C2;$A$1 : $G$21;7;0)  и растянем её на диапазон E2:F21.

PIC

В ячейку H2 впишем формулу =МАКС(G2:G21)-МИН(G2:G21). Полученное значение и будет являться ответом.

Ответ: 95
Оцените статью
Я решу все!